Early Life and Education: John Boyne, born on April 30, 1971, in Dublin, Ireland, has emerged as one of contemporary literature's most compelling voices. Raised in a culturally rich environment, he developed a passion for storytelling at an early age. Boyne pursued his education at the University of East Anglia, where he cultivated his writing skills, ultimately earning a Master’s degree in Creative Writing. This academic foundation has served as a springboard for a prolific literary career.

Literary Achievements: Boyne gained international acclaim with his novel "The Boy in the Striped Pyjamas," published in 2006. The book, which explores themes of innocence and the horrors of war through the eyes of a child, resonated with readers worldwide and has been translated into over fifty languages. His ability to tackle complex historical themes through accessible narratives has established Boyne as a significant figure in modern literature. Over the years, he has authored numerous novels, including "The Absolutist," "A History of Loneliness," and "The Heart's Invisible Furies," each showcasing his versatility and depth as a writer.

Themes and Style: John Boyne's writing is characterized by its emotional resonance and moral complexity. He often delves into themes of identity, loss, and the human condition, providing readers with thought-provoking narratives that linger long after the last page. His distinctive style blends poignant storytelling with rich character development, allowing readers to connect deeply with his characters and their journeys. Boyne’s works often reflect his keen interest in history, offering a lens through which to examine societal issues and personal dilemmas.

Current Endeavors: As of 2023, John Boyne continues to write and engage with readers globally. His dedication to literature extends beyond authorship; he is an advocate for various social issues, using his platform to raise awareness about topics such as LGBTQ+ rights and mental health. With a growing body of work and a reputation for compelling storytelling, Boyne remains a vital and influential voice in contemporary fiction, captivating audiences with each new release.
